With an average age of 53 among farmers in Quebec, family farms are under pressure to either sell or expand.

On Rang 5 in St-Louis-de-Gonzague, while neighbors abandon dairy production, two brothers and their three sons, partners in the Montcalm farm, are investing $3 million in a state-of-the-art barn and cutting-edge robots. This debt will weigh heavily on them for years to come. But they see no other option if they want the next generation to continue the work started by their elders over 100 years ago.

Family Farm offers a human portrait of dairy production, the transfer of a family business between generations, the impact of modern values on rural life, and the uncertain future of this facet of our cultural identity.
